Consider the venture capital firms that have poured billions into blockchain startups. These aren't your average angel investors; they are seasoned professionals with teams of analysts, researchers, and strategists who conduct deep dives into the technology, the team, the tokenomics, and the potential market penetration of each project. Their investments are a strong signal to the broader market. When a prominent VC firm like Andreessen Horowitz's a16z Crypto, Paradigm, or Pantera Capital backs a new protocol, it's not merely a financial endorsement; it's a stamp of approval that validates the project's potential and attracts further attention, talent, and capital. This creates a virtuous cycle, where early smart money investment fuels growth, development, and adoption, ultimately leading to broader market recognition and value appreciation.

The evolution of "smart money" in blockchain also highlights a growing understanding of tokenomics – the design of the economic incentives within a blockchain ecosystem. Smart investors are not just looking at the technology; they are scrutinizing the token supply, distribution, utility, and governance mechanisms. A well-designed tokenomics model can align the interests of all stakeholders, fostering long-term growth and sustainability. Conversely, poorly conceived tokenomics can lead to price manipulation, unsustainable inflation, or a lack of genuine utility, deterring smart money. Therefore, discerning investors are meticulously analyzing these economic frameworks, seeking projects where the token serves a real purpose and creates tangible value for its holders and the ecosystem as a whole.
The transparency inherent in blockchain technology, while empowering, also makes the movements of "smart money" more observable. On-chain analytics platforms are providing unprecedented visibility into wallet movements, smart contract interactions, and the flow of funds. This data allows observers to identify patterns, track the accumulation of assets by known sophisticated players, and even detect early signs of potential market shifts. This democratizes a certain level of insight, allowing smaller investors to learn from, or at least observe, the strategies of those with deeper pockets and potentially deeper knowledge. However, it's crucial to remember that correlation does not equal causation, and simply following the perceived "smart money" without understanding the underlying rationale can be a risky endeavor. The true intelligence lies in deciphering why smart money is moving in a particular direction.

The emergence of venture DAOs (Decentralized Autonomous Organizations) further illustrates this shift. These organizations, governed by token holders, pool capital and collectively decide on investment strategies within the blockchain space. This represents a democratized form of smart money, where a community of informed individuals, rather than a centralized entity, makes investment decisions. The success of these DAOs hinges on the collective intelligence and informed participation of their members, a testament to the growing emphasis on community and shared governance in the blockchain world.
Beyond institutional and community-driven smart money, there's also the phenomenon of "whale" activity. Whales are individuals or entities that hold a significant amount of a particular cryptocurrency. When a whale makes a large purchase or sale, it can have a substantial impact on the market. Smart money whales are not necessarily acting on impulse; they often have a long-term conviction in specific projects and accumulate assets during periods of market downturn, anticipating future growth. Tracking their on-chain movements can provide valuable insights, but it's essential to differentiate between strategic accumulation and potential market manipulation.

Furthermore, smart money is actively exploring and investing in the burgeoning fields of Web3 infrastructure. This includes companies building the foundational layers of the decentralized internet, such as decentralized storage solutions, oracle networks (which provide real-world data to blockchains), and layer-2 scaling solutions that enhance transaction speed and reduce costs. These are the critical components that enable the broader adoption and functionality of blockchain applications, and smart money recognizes their fundamental importance for the long-term success of the entire ecosystem.

Technical Challenges
One of the primary technical challenges is scalability. As the number of transactions increases, so does the complexity and computational load on the blockchain network. This can lead to slower transaction times and higher costs. To address this, various solutions are being explored, including layer-two protocols, sharding, and the development of more efficient consensus algorithms.
Another technical challenge is interoperability. Different blockchains often use different protocols and data formats, which can make it difficult to integrate them into existing financial systems. Efforts are underway to create standards and frameworks that facilitate seamless communication between different blockchain networks.
